Mowbray Cemetery was established in the late 1800s on the slopes of Devil’s Peak against the picturesque backdrop of Table Mountain. The renowned site is the resting place of many members of the community including historical figures. Mowbray Cemetery is located next to the Groote Schuur Hospital, famous for being the institution where the first heart transplant took place.
